> patch-scripts has the "patch-bomb" script,
Aha - interesting.
Actually, I was asking a loaded question. I just finished writing my
own patch bomber. I see a few details in your patch-bomb worth stealing
- thanks. Mine is more driven off of a single text file, that specifies
what files, with what subjects, to send to whom. And its in Python.
The big feature (?) mine has is to set the Message-Id, In-Reply-To and
References fields so that all but the first one in the set appear to be
followups to the first one, for those using threaded email readers.
Hard to do that with smtpsend in the shell ;).
